Carthage Men's Swimming Coach Greg Earhart Steps Aside for 2010-11

Andrew Belton Named Interim Head Coach

7/23/2010 7:38:57 PM

Carthage College director of athletics Robert Bonn has named Andrew Belton interim head men's swimming coach for 2010-11. Current head coach Greg Earhart will take a leave of absence beginning Sept. 1, 2010 and will resume his duties on April 1, 2011. Earhart  (67-23 dual-meet record, 8 years) was named the College Conference of Illinois and Wisconsin's "Men's Swimming Coach of the Year" in 2002, 2006 and 2010 and CCIW “Co-Men's Swimming Coach of the Year” in 2004. The Red Men won CCIW titles in 2006, 2008, 2009 and 2010. 

A native of San Antonio, Texas, Belton attended the University of Wisconsin-Milwaukee where he graduated in 2009 with a bachelor's in civil engineering. He served as a volunteer assistant coach at Wisconsin-Milwaukee in 2009-10, and he is also an assistant at the North Shore Swim Club. Belton was a three-year member of the Wisconsin-Milwaukee swimming team from 2007 to 2009 after transferring from Ohio University.
